With this latest go I gave River, QTile, and Niri a try. After a bit of swapping back and forth, I've settled on Niri and am slowly adding functionality I'm missing.
- I like multiple dynamic workspaces (grouped by function) and don't see much point beyond a split or two so Niri worked pretty well, and I was able to largely config all the keyboard shortcuts to something that made sense to me
- I'm using waybar and swaync for my other DE bits
I've also been using long running Claude Code/Codex in a workspace to build a number of custom scripts:
- niri-workspaces - dynamically generate a workspace display on my waybar showing windows, activity
- niri-workspace-names - integrate w/ fuzzel to let me rename workpaces
- niri-alttab - getting app cycling working in a way that makes sense to me, this is a larger project probably if I want live thumbnails and the like
- niri-terminal-below - I often want to have a new vertical terminal split and it's a bit hacky but works (have to punch out a new terminal, then bring it below, and move back if on the right side)
I haven't gone through all the docs, done much looking around, but one nice thing with these new coding agents is that they can just go and do a passable job to tweak as I want.
